This is part of a regular planned redeployment of @USArmy's 🇺🇸 forces stationed in Lithuania 🇱🇹 for 9 months in support of Operations #AtlanticResolve and European Assure, Deter, and Reinforce #EADR. It concerns 1st Battalion, 12th Cavalry Regiment and 2nd Battalion, 82nd Field Artillery Regiment from the 3rd Armored Brigade Combat Team ("Greywolf"), 1st Cavalry Division. Both units officially took responsibility during transfer of authority ceremony at Camp Herkus, Lithuania, on Oct. 3, 2025. "Greywolf" Brigade was supposed to be replaced by the 2nd Armored Brigade Combat Team (“Black Jack”), 1st Cavalry Division, however the deployment was abruptly canceled in mid-May. lrt.lt/en/news-in-english/19…

U.S. 🇺🇸 2nd Armored Brigade Combat Team, 1st Cavalry Division, has been deploying to Poland 🇵🇱 as regular planned Armored Brigade Combat Team (ABCT) rotation. It hasn’t been delayed. It has been recently paused/cancelled with some of its elements already deployed at forward operating sites. Will mentioned below reduction affect this brigade and following ABCTs? What is effective date of reduction from four to three ABCTs?
STATEMENT: The Department of War has reduced the total number of Brigade Combat Teams (BCTs) assigned to Europe from four to three. This returns us to the levels of BCTs in Europe in 2021. This decision was the result of a comprehensive, multilayered process focused on U.S. force posture in Europe. This is resulting in a temporary delay of the deployment of U.S. forces to Poland, which is a model U.S. ally. The Department will determine the final disposition of these and other U.S. forces in Europe based on further analysis of U.S. strategic and operational requirements, as well as our allies’ own ability to contribute forces toward Europe’s defense. This analysis is designed to advance President Trump’s America First agenda in Europe and other theaters, including by incentivizing and enabling our NATO allies to take primary responsibility for Europe’s conventional defense. Secretary Hegseth spoke with Polish Deputy Prime Minister Kosiniak-Kamysz earlier today, and the Department will remain in close contact with our Polish counterparts as this analysis proceeds, including to ensure that the United States retains a strong military presence in Poland. Poland has shown both the ability and resolve to defend itself. Other NATO allies should follow suit. The Department will provide more information at the appropriate time, in the appropriate setting.

Na jakich zasadach żołnierze z 🇺🇸 @2dCavalryRegt mieliby niby stacjonować w Polsce 🇵🇱, jeśli w Niemczech 🇩🇪 jest to obecność stała (PCS - Permanent Change of Station) uprawniająca m.in. do pobytu żołnierzy wraz z rodzinami i przysługującym całym pakietem wsparcia socjalnego (przedszkola, szkoły, wynajem domów/mieszkań, itd.)? Kolejna planowa rotacja #ABCT tj. 2 Pancernego Brygadowego Zespołu Bojowego @1stCavalryDiv (2/1 CD) miała być zapewne dyslokowana w tych samych kompleksach wojskowych (UOiT - Uzgodnionych Obiektach i Terenach, zgodnie z Aneksem A Umowy #EDCA), w których stacjonował ich poprzednik (3/1CD). W UOiT w Polsce siły zbrojne USA są uprawnione do otrzymania #WLZPP - wsparcia logistycznego zapewnianego przez Polskę. O jakiej niejednoznaczności Pan mówi, jeśli lokalizacje dla #ABCT są jasno określone i testowane w praktyce przez poprzednie zmiany ABCT?
W związku z zamieszaniem wokół kwestii wojskowej obecności USA w RP, wywołanym doniesieniami mediów, Biuro Bezpieczeństwa Narodowego wskazuje, że Stany Zjednoczone są naszym najważniejszym partnerem strategicznym i obok naszych żołnierzy i funkcjonariuszy - gwarantem bezpieczeństwa Rzeczypospolitej Polskiej. W Polsce żołnierze USA realizują swoje zadania w ramach: 1.wysuniętej obecności NATO (Forward Land Forces - FLF), 2.operacji Atlantic Resolve poprzez V Korpus USA, w ramach którego w kilku lokalizacjach rozmieszczona jest Brygadowa Grupa Pancerna (ABCT) i pozostałe komponenty sił zbrojnych. 3.bazy antyrakietowej AEGIS ASHORE w Redzikowie, - Łączna liczba żołnierzy i pracowników cywilnych amerykańskiego wojska w Polsce nie jest stała i oscyluje w granicach ok. 10 000. - Komponent stały obecności USA w Polsce to zasadniczo obsługa bazy antyrakietowej w Redzikowie oraz elementy dowodzenia i logistyczne V Korpusu z siedzibą w Poznaniu. - Zasadniczymi komponentami niestałej obecności USA w Polsce są elementy Brygadowej Grupy Pancernej (ABCT). - Obecność USA jest wielodomenowa; składają się na nią nie tylko siły lądowe ale również komponent powietrzny, śmigłowcowy i wojsk specjalnych, a także elementy dowodzenia, rozpoznania oraz logistyka. - W samym komponencie lądowym, w ramach rotacji Brygadowej Grupy Pancernej, na terenie Polski działa ponad 5 000 żołnierzy USA. W relacji do średniorocznych stanów obecności sił USA w Polsce nie jest to liczba niska. - Obecny, zmienny stan ilościowy ma związek z trwającą rotacją sił USA w naszej części Europy. Rotację prowadzi Pierwsza Dywizja Kawalerii USA z Fort Hood w Teksasie (1st Cavalry Division). - Trwa przemieszczenie i narastanie sił USA w Polsce. Do dzisiaj z Fort Hood przemieszczono do Polski już ponad 20% planowanej liczby żołnierzy, a także ok. 70% sprzętu wojskowego, co jest kluczowym czynnikiem gotowości sił. - W ocenie BBN doniesienia o wstrzymaniu rotacji i zmniejszeniu obecności USA nie dotyczą bezpośrednio i docelowo Polski. - Oceniamy, że zmiany w harmonogramach rotacji mają związek z zamiarem wycofania z Niemiec 2 pułku kawalerii (2CR) z Vilseck w Niemczech. Po wycofaniu z Niemiec jednostka ta może zostać przewidziana do zastąpienia części wcześniej planowanej do Polski Brygadowej Grupy Pancernej. - Obecna niejednoznaczność może mieć związek z brakiem jasnej propozycji zmian do Umowy o Wzmocnionej Współpracy Obronnej (EDCA) z 2020 r., określającej rozmieszczenie sił USA w Polsce i braku wskazania przez MON nowych lokalizacji. - MON nie pozyskało wyprzedzających informacji w zakresie zmian w harmonogramie przemieszczenia sił USA do Polski, co utrudnia zaangażowanie Ośrodka Prezydenckiego we wsparcie MON w negocjacjach z naszym partnerem strategicznym.
